Spay surgery is recommended after the bitch has produced puppies. WebDec 10, 2024 · A: Ovaries are the drivers of pyometra, not the uterus. Pyometra is a hormonally driven process and is an abnormal uterine response to repeated exposure of the hormone called progesterone. If the ovaries of your dog are removed, then a pyometra can’t occur because the source of progesterone has been removed. A lap spay accomplishes …

WebMar 26, 2024 · Spaying can also prevent pyometra, which is an infection of the uterus. Pyometra is a medical emergency that, if left untreated, is usually fatal. Pyometra will affect roughly 1 in 4 non-spayed females before the age of 10 years, but can occur in dogs older than this. Additionally, spaying greatly decreases the risk of mammary (breast) cancer ... WebHow quickly does pyometra develop? Certain bacteria are more virulent than others and therefore allow a bacterium that is normally found on the dog to develop into an infection. Pyometra is most commonly seen in intact dogs 4-8 weeks after estrus (mean time of 5.4 weeks); however, it can be seen 4 months post estrus as well.

WebSep 15, 2024 · Pyometra is a serious disease of the uterus that can affect unspayed female cats. Prompt veterinary care is important if a cat does develop pyometra. The condition can be completely prevented by spaying, which is one of the reasons for the strong recommendation in favor of routine spaying for all cats not intended for breeding.

WebFeb 16, 2024 · The best and only prevention for pyometra is to have your dog spayed. Spaying (whether by removing the uterus and ovaries or just the ovaries) removes the hormonal stimulation that causes both heat cycles and the uterine changes that allow pyometra to happen.

WebMost bitches that have been spayed will not get pyometra. But, if your dog has only had part of her womb removed during neutering or part of the tissue has been left behind, this could become infected.
